What does Transurban’s Journey into the Future mean for you?

Journey into the Future is an 18-month rotational graduate program, starting in late January 2025. The program is designed to give YOU the depth of knowledge and experience you need to kick start your career.

As an Engineering Graduate, your contributions will matter. From day one, you’ll be encouraged to share your ideas and apply your expertise to create better ways of working, building, and doing.

You’ll explore three different business areas for six months at a time, where your advice will count, your responsibilities will be real and your decisions will have impact. Areas may include Project Delivery, Maintenance, Planning or Strategic Operations.

And you won't just be stuck in an office all day, either. You’ll be out among it, seeing some of our cities’ biggest projects up close. Experience what it's like to be inside a tunnel, beneath a bridge, in our Habitat Filter, or go straight to where all the action happens – inside our Traffic Control Room. 

Your buddies and mentors will be there to guide and support you, while our senior leaders, technical specialists and formal learning paths will help you hone your leadership skills.

Our Engineering Graduates can be based in Melbourne, Sydney or Brisbane.

Eligibility to apply: 

  • You’re on track to graduate this year, or have already graduated last year, with an undergraduate or postgraduate degree in a Civil, Mechanical or Electrical Engineering or something similar. Any double degrees with business or commerce are advantageous, though not essential.
  • You’re an Australian Citizen, Permanent Resident, NZ Citizen or you must hold unrestricted working rights in Australia from January 2025 for the entirety of the 18-month program.


With a career at Transurban, you’ll enjoy a range of benefits, including:  

  • A range of flexible working and leave options, including the option to purchase an additional six weeks of leave each year.  
  • 16 weeks paid parental leave (regardless of gender or carer status), with no waiting period, with Superannuation paid during unpaid leave as well.
  • Learning and development opportunities to support your career interests. 
  • Health and wellbeing support—access to Headspace and our EAP program, wellness facilities, and more. 
  • Share offers and insurance benefits.
  • Social activities, community give-back programs and paid volunteer days.
